Kalda
Kalda is a village located in Nowrozabad tehsil of Umaria district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Nowroazbad (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Umaria. As per 2009 stats, Kalda village is also a gram panchayat.

About Kalda
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kalda is 468231. The village spans a total geographical area of 1106.51 hectares. Nowrozabad is nearest town to Kalda village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Kalda
Below is a concise population overview of Kalda as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,258 | 623 | 635 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 199 | 106 | 93 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 8 | 6 | 2 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 1,088 | 539 | 549 |
Literate Population | 613 | 345 | 268 |
Illiterate Population | 645 | 278 | 367 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kalda village:
- The total population of Kalda village is around 1,258, including approximately 623 males and 635 females, with a sex ratio of 1019 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 199 children aged 0–6 years in Kalda village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Kalda village has 8 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 1,088 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Kalda village is about 48.73%, with male literacy at 55.38% and female literacy at 42.20%.
- There are around 256 households in Kalda village.
Connectivity of Kalda
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kalda. As per the 2011 stats, Kalda had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
